Bonjour, @Loic
Tu n’a pas répondu ici :
Bonjour, @Loic
Tu n’a pas répondu ici :
Je n’ai pas vu de double appui dans les log donc pas ajouté
Ok et pour les retombées d’état ?
J’ai repondu deja plus haut
pas trouvé bon tempi j’ai déjà un scenario pour dommage.
Bonjour Loic
Sur mon export du Plug Osram Extérieur, j’ai bien les infos manufacturer et model.
J’espère que tu pourras le rajouter. Merci
{
"ieee": "7c:b0:3e:aa:00:af:32:30",
"nwk": 60607,
"status": 2,
"lqi": "63",
"rssi": "-86",
"last_seen": "1614017600.2734919",
"node_descriptor": "01:40:8e:aa:bb:40:00:00:00:00:00:00:03",
"endpoints": [
{
"id": 3,
"status": 1,
"device_type": 16,
"profile_id": 49246,
"manufacturer": "OSRAM",
"model": "Plug 01",
"output_clusters": [
{
"id": 25,
"name": "Ota",
"attributes": []
}
],
"input_clusters": [
{
"id": 0,
"name": "Basic",
"attributes": [
{
"id": 0,
"name": "zcl_version",
"value": 1
},
{
"id": 1,
"name": "app_version",
"value": 144
},
{
"id": 2,
"name": "stack_version",
"value": 2
},
{
"id": 3,
"name": "hw_version",
"value": 1
},
{
"id": 4,
"name": "manufacturer",
"value": "OSRAM"
},
{
"id": 5,
"name": "model",
"value": "Plug 01"
},
{
"id": 6,
"name": "date_code",
"value": "20140331DEOS****"
},
{
"id": 7,
"name": "power_source",
"value": 1
},
{
"id": 16384,
"name": "sw_build_id",
"value": "V1.04.90"
}
]
},
{
"id": 3,
"name": "Identify",
"attributes": []
},
{
"id": 4,
"name": "Groups",
"attributes": []
},
{
"id": 5,
"name": "Scenes",
"attributes": []
},
{
"id": 6,
"name": "On\/Off",
"attributes": [
{
"id": 0,
"name": "on_off",
"value": 0
}
]
},
{
"id": 4096,
"name": "LightLink",
"attributes": []
},
{
"id": 64527,
"name": "Manufacturer Specific",
"attributes": []
}
]
}
],
"signature": {
"manufacturer": "OSRAM",
"model": "Plug 01",
"node_desc": {
"byte1": 1,
"byte2": 64,
"mac_capability_flags": 142,
"manufacturer_code": 48042,
"maximum_buffer_size": 64,
"maximum_incoming_transfer_size": 0,
"server_mask": 0,
"maximum_outgoing_transfer_size": 0,
"descriptor_capability_field": 3
},
"endpoints": {
"3": {
"profile_id": 49246,
"device_type": 16,
"input_clusters": [
0,
3,
4,
5,
6,
4096,
64527
],
"output_clusters": [
25
]
}
}
},
"class": "zhaquirks.osram.osramplug"
}
cela ressemble a ce model de chez ledvance qui est en ZLL
actuellement j’utilise cette configue, j’arrive a faire le on-off mais pas de retour d’état
en espérant que avec ton retour @Loic puisse l’intégrer
Bonjour,
j’ai une sirene Heiman qui remonte mais n’est pas reconnue.
Si vous pouvez l’ajouter :
et le json
{
"ieee": "00:0d:6f:00:13:1a:cb:0b",
"nwk": 3421,
"status": 2,
"lqi": "132",
"rssi": "-62",
"last_seen": "1614023897.002188",
"node_descriptor": "01:40:8e:0b:12:52:52:00:00:00:52:00:00",
"endpoints": [
{
"id": 1,
"status": 1,
"device_type": 1027,
"profile_id": 260,
"manufacturer": "Heiman",
"model": "WarningDevice",
"output_clusters": [
{
"id": 3,
"name": "Identify",
"attributes": []
},
{
"id": 25,
"name": "Ota",
"attributes": []
}
],
"input_clusters": [
{
"id": 0,
"name": "Basic",
"attributes": [
{
"id": 0,
"name": "zcl_version",
"value": 1
},
{
"id": 1,
"name": "app_version",
"value": 18
},
{
"id": 2,
"name": "stack_version",
"value": 2
},
{
"id": 3,
"name": "hw_version",
"value": 16
},
{
"id": 4,
"name": "manufacturer",
"value": "Heiman"
},
{
"id": 5,
"name": "model",
"value": "WarningDevice"
},
{
"id": 6,
"name": "date_code",
"value": "2018.03.21"
},
{
"id": 7,
"name": "power_source",
"value": 129
}
]
},
{
"id": 1,
"name": "Power Configuration",
"attributes": [
{
"id": 32,
"name": "battery_voltage",
"value": 37
},
{
"id": 33,
"name": "battery_percentage_remaining",
"value": 82
}
]
},
{
"id": 3,
"name": "Identify",
"attributes": []
},
{
"id": 4,
"name": "Groups",
"attributes": []
},
{
"id": 9,
"name": "Alarms",
"attributes": []
},
{
"id": 1280,
"name": "IAS Zone",
"attributes": []
},
{
"id": 1282,
"name": "IAS Warning Device",
"attributes": []
}
]
}
],
"signature": {
"manufacturer": "Heiman",
"model": "WarningDevice",
"node_desc": {
"byte1": 1,
"byte2": 64,
"mac_capability_flags": 142,
"manufacturer_code": 4619,
"maximum_buffer_size": 82,
"maximum_incoming_transfer_size": 82,
"server_mask": 0,
"maximum_outgoing_transfer_size": 82,
"descriptor_capability_field": 0
},
"endpoints": {
"1": {
"profile_id": 260,
"device_type": 1027,
"input_clusters": [
0,
1,
3,
4,
9,
1280,
1282
],
"output_clusters": [
3,
25
]
}
}
},
"class": "zigpy.device"
}
Merci beaucoup
Bonsoir @Loic,
Je viens de recevoir un Smart Dial référencé TERNCY-SD01, serait il possible de l’ajouter ? Le « Manufacturer » est « null », mais il semblerait que ça soit fabriqué par Xiaoyan. Il y a a priori des actions sur la rotation, et sur le clic.
{
"ieee": "00:0d:6f:00:16:73:d1:16",
"nwk": 32996,
"status": 2,
"lqi": "255",
"rssi": "-50",
"last_seen": "1614026955.6982696",
"node_descriptor": "02:40:80:28:12:52:52:00:00:2c:52:00:00",
"endpoints": [
{
"id": 1,
"status": 1,
"device_type": 498,
"profile_id": 260,
"manufacturer": null,
"model": "TERNCY-SD01",
"output_clusters": [
{
"id": 25,
"name": "Ota",
"attributes": []
}
],
"input_clusters": [
{
"id": 0,
"name": "Basic",
"attributes": [
{
"id": 0,
"name": "zcl_version",
"value": 3
},
{
"id": 5,
"name": "model",
"value": "TERNCY-SD01"
},
{
"id": 7,
"name": "power_source",
"value": 3
}
]
},
{
"id": 1,
"name": "Power Configuration",
"attributes": []
},
{
"id": 3,
"name": "Identify",
"attributes": []
},
{
"id": 32,
"name": "Poll Control",
"attributes": []
},
{
"id": 64716,
"name": "Terncy Raw cluster",
"attributes": []
}
]
}
],
"signature": {
"model": "TERNCY-SD01",
"node_desc": {
"byte1": 2,
"byte2": 64,
"mac_capability_flags": 128,
"manufacturer_code": 4648,
"maximum_buffer_size": 82,
"maximum_incoming_transfer_size": 82,
"server_mask": 11264,
"maximum_outgoing_transfer_size": 82,
"descriptor_capability_field": 0
},
"endpoints": {
"1": {
"profile_id": 260,
"device_type": 498,
"input_clusters": [
0,
1,
3,
32,
64716
],
"output_clusters": [
25
]
}
}
},
"class": "zhaquirks.terncy.sd01"
}
Voici l’image correspondante :
Merci d’avance.
Bonjour,
C’est du zll (l’ancetre du zigbee) donc les retours d’état ne sont pas automatique (il faut interroger le module). Dans la beta de demain la commande refresh sera la et permettra de la faire
Bonjour,
Ca sera disponible demain dans la beta
Bonjour,
Il faudrait jouer avec le bouton et m’envoyer la log filtré zigbee (tout court) pour que je vois ce qu’il remonte.
Bonjour Loic,
Je suis au niveau « debug » niveau log, et j’ai pas grand chose qui sort, même si le témoin d’activité du module s’allume, et que la valeur « last seen » évolue:
[2021-02-23 15:58:09][DEBUG] : {"ieee":"00:0d:6f:00:16:73:d1:16"}
[2021-02-23 15:59:16][DEBUG] : {"ieee":"00:0d:6f:00:16:73:d1:16"}
[2021-02-23 15:59:31][DEBUG] : {"ieee":"00:0d:6f:00:16:73:d1:16","nwk":32996,"status":2,"lqi":"223","rssi":"-66","last_seen":"1614092244.3871684","node_descriptor":"02:40:80:28:12:52:52:00:00:2c:52:00:00","endpoints":[{"id":1,"status":1,"device_type":498,"profile_id":260,"manufacturer":null,"model":"TERNCY-SD01","output_clusters":[{"id":25,"name":"Ota","attributes":[]}],"input_clusters":[{"id":0,"name":"Basic","attributes":[{"id":0,"name":"zcl_version","value":3},{"id":5,"name":"model","value":"TERNCY-SD01"},{"id":7,"name":"power_source","value":3}]},{"id":1,"name":"Power Configuration","attributes":[]},{"id":3,"name":"Identify","attributes":[]},{"id":32,"name":"Poll Control","attributes":[]},{"id":64716,"name":"Terncy Raw cluster","attributes":[]}]}],"signature":{"model":"TERNCY-SD01","node_desc":{"byte1":2,"byte2":64,"mac_capability_flags":128,"manufacturer_code":4648,"maximum_buffer_size":82,"maximum_incoming_transfer_size":82,"server_mask":11264,"maximum_outgoing_transfer_size":82,"descriptor_capability_field":0},"endpoints":{"1":{"profile_id":260,"device_type":498,"input_clusters":[0,1,3,32,64716],"output_clusters":[25]}}},"class":"zhaquirks.terncy.sd01"}
Ai-je un paramètre incorrect ? J’ai aussi des messages qui semblent être plus du contrôleur vers le module (voir zigbee.log (171,5 Ko) )
Merci pour votre aide.
Bon ben je pense c’est mort ca semble tout proprietaire…
Petite contribution a ajouter
{
"ieee": "01:12:4b:00:1c:2e:84:90",
"nwk": 54478,
"status": 2,
"lqi": "192",
"rssi": "-52",
"last_seen": "1614096963.2800467",
"node_descriptor": "01:40:8e:00:00:50:a0:00:00:00:a0:00:00",
"endpoints": [
{
"id": 11,
"status": 1,
"device_type": 256,
"profile_id": 260,
"manufacturer": "SZ",
"model": "Lamp_01",
"output_clusters": [
{
"id": 0,
"name": "Basic",
"attributes": []
}
],
"input_clusters": [
{
"id": 0,
"name": "Basic",
"attributes": [
{
"id": 0,
"name": "zcl_version",
"value": 1
},
{
"id": 1,
"name": "app_version",
"value": 1
},
{
"id": 3,
"name": "hw_version",
"value": 1
},
{
"id": 4,
"name": "manufacturer",
"value": "SZ"
},
{
"id": 5,
"name": "model",
"value": "Lamp_01"
},
{
"id": 6,
"name": "date_code",
"value": "20181107"
},
{
"id": 7,
"name": "power_source",
"value": 1
}
]
},
{
"id": 3,
"name": "Identify",
"attributes": []
},
{
"id": 4,
"name": "Groups",
"attributes": []
},
{
"id": 5,
"name": "Scenes",
"attributes": []
},
{
"id": 6,
"name": "On\/Off",
"attributes": [
{
"id": 0,
"name": "on_off",
"value": 1
}
]
}
]
}
],
"signature": {
"manufacturer": "SZ",
"model": "Lamp_01",
"node_desc": {
"byte1": 1,
"byte2": 64,
"mac_capability_flags": 142,
"manufacturer_code": 0,
"maximum_buffer_size": 80,
"maximum_incoming_transfer_size": 160,
"server_mask": 0,
"maximum_outgoing_transfer_size": 160,
"descriptor_capability_field": 0
},
"endpoints": {
"11": {
"profile_id": 260,
"device_type": 256,
"input_clusters": [
0,
3,
4,
5,
6
],
"output_clusters": [
0
]
}
}
},
"class": "zigpy.device"
}
Bonjour,
Ca sera disponible dans la beta de demain. merci
Bonjour,
Après avoir lu de bons commentaires j’ai acheté et reçu aujourd’hui des ampoules LEXMAN E27 RGB vendu ICI 12,90€ pièce par Leroy Merlin (compatible ENKI).
A première vue ces ampoules sont aussi puissantes en blanc qu’en couleur (ce qui n’est pas le cas des modèles Lidl équivalents). J’ai hâte de tester
Voici l’image détourée :
Et voici les informations brutes :
{
"ieee": "5c:02:72:ff:fe:2e:0a:db",
"nwk": 27945,
"status": 2,
"lqi": "172",
"rssi": "-57",
"last_seen": "1614102959.232533",
"node_descriptor": "01:40:8e:77:12:52:52:00:00:2c:52:00:00",
"endpoints": [
{
"id": 1,
"status": 1,
"device_type": 269,
"profile_id": 260,
"manufacturer": "Adeo",
"model": "LXEK-1",
"output_clusters": [
{
"id": 25,
"name": "Ota",
"attributes": []
}
],
"input_clusters": [
{
"id": 0,
"name": "Basic",
"attributes": [
{
"id": 0,
"name": "zcl_version",
"value": 3
},
{
"id": 1,
"name": "app_version",
"value": 1
},
{
"id": 2,
"name": "stack_version",
"value": 2
},
{
"id": 3,
"name": "hw_version",
"value": 1
},
{
"id": 4,
"name": "manufacturer",
"value": "Adeo"
},
{
"id": 5,
"name": "model",
"value": "LXEK-1"
},
{
"id": 6,
"name": "date_code",
"value": "20200526"
},
{
"id": 7,
"name": "power_source",
"value": 1
},
{
"id": 16384,
"name": "sw_build_id",
"value": "2.4.0"
}
]
},
{
"id": 3,
"name": "Identify",
"attributes": []
},
{
"id": 4,
"name": "Groups",
"attributes": []
},
{
"id": 5,
"name": "Scenes",
"attributes": []
},
{
"id": 6,
"name": "On\/Off",
"attributes": []
},
{
"id": 8,
"name": "Level control",
"attributes": []
},
{
"id": 768,
"name": "Color Control",
"attributes": []
},
{
"id": 4096,
"name": "LightLink",
"attributes": []
},
{
"id": 64642,
"name": "Manufacturer Specific",
"attributes": []
}
]
},
{
"id": 242,
"status": 1,
"device_type": 97,
"profile_id": 41440,
"manufacturer": null,
"model": null,
"output_clusters": [
{
"id": 33,
"name": "GreenPowerProxy",
"attributes": []
}
],
"input_clusters": []
}
],
"signature": {
"manufacturer": "Adeo",
"model": "LXEK-1",
"node_desc": {
"byte1": 1,
"byte2": 64,
"mac_capability_flags": 142,
"manufacturer_code": 4727,
"maximum_buffer_size": 82,
"maximum_incoming_transfer_size": 82,
"server_mask": 11264,
"maximum_outgoing_transfer_size": 82,
"descriptor_capability_field": 0
},
"endpoints": {
"1": {
"profile_id": 260,
"device_type": 269,
"input_clusters": [
0,
3,
4,
5,
6,
8,
768,
4096,
64642
],
"output_clusters": [
25
]
},
"242": {
"profile_id": 41440,
"device_type": 97,
"input_clusters": [],
"output_clusters": [
33
]
}
}
},
"class": "zigpy.device"
}
Merci @Loic
Bonjour, Loïc
Merci pour le spot Swing (TZ3000_40zcsvfv.TS0502A).
Il s’intègre maintenant directement et est bien reconnu.
Pourrais-tu faire une dernière correction : mettre le minimum de l’action de luminosité à 3 au lieu de 0.
Si on fait une mise à jour de luminosité à 0, 1 ou 2, elle est sans effet.
Elle ne fonctionne bien qu’à partir de 3.
Merci d’avance.
Bonjour,
Ca sera bon dans la beta de demain merci pour le retour